Vulnerability Description
ccnl_ccntlv_bytes2pkt in CCN-lite allows context-dependent attackers to cause a denial of service (application crash) via vectors involving packets with "wrong L values."
CVSS Score
HIGH
Affected Products
| Vendor | Product | Versions |
|---|---|---|
| Ccn-Lite | Ccn-Lite | < 2.0.0 |
